NZ whisky makes UK debut

Central Otago could also be greatest recognized to Decanter readers for its Pinot Noirs, however the area can be dwelling to Scapegrace distillery. Arrange in 2014, Scapegrace plans to launch a signature single malt in 2024, however within the meantime is releasing a small variety of limited-edition single malts. ‘Now we have the pure sources to create a number of the greatest whisky on this planet,’ stated co-founder Daniel McLaughlin. The vary contains: Rise I and Refrain II, each aged in new French oak, for 5 and three years respectively. Timbre IV is aged in Bulgarian oak for 3 years. However decide of the bunch is Revenant III (Alc 46%, obtainable from Grasp of Malt), made utilizing manuka wood-smoked laureate barley and aged in new French oak for 3 years. Honeyed caramel on a smoky nostril, hints of peppery spice; gently smoky palate with notes of dried citrus peel, vanilla toffee and chilli spice, lengthy end with a waft of woodsmoke. All: Alc 46%, Grasp of Malt, The Whisky Change


What’s… aquafaba?

Aquafaba is the water that chickpeas have been cooked in. Why are we mentioning it within the spirits pages? As a result of because of its viscous texture it’s a really perfect substitute for egg whites in cocktail recipes. It’s now more and more utilized in bars to make vegan variations of drinks: from Pisco Sours and Whisky Sours to the Clover Membership and White Woman. Two tablespoons of aquafaba equates to at least one egg white. It would hold within the fridge for as much as per week or could be frozen for as much as three months.


What to drink now… Hanky Panky

If Valentine’s Day has you feeling amorous, why not take pleasure in a bit of Hanky Panky? This variation on a candy Martini makes use of Fernet-Branca (an Italian amaro). It’s the primary traditional cocktail recipe that may be definitively attributed to a feminine bartender. Ada ‘Coley’ Coleman was head bartender on the American Bar at London’s Savoy resort within the early Twenties, a time when ‘hanky panky’ meant a magical spell, like ‘hocus pocus’. The recipe requires a London Dry model of gin: attempt No3 London Dry Gin by Berry Bros & Rudd. Distilled with simply six botanicals, it’s a superbly balanced gin that works completely in Martinis (Alc 46%, Amazon, Asda, Berry Bros & Rudd, Harvey Nichols, Majestic, Ocado, The Whisky Change, Waitrose).

Hanky Panky

Substances: 45ml London dry gin, 45ml candy purple vermouth, 7.5ml Fernet-Branca

Glass: Martini

Garnish: Orange twist

Methodology: Put all the components in a mixing jar with ice and stir to mix. Pressure into a calming cocktail glass. Zest a twist of orange peel excessive and garnish.
